Overview

Postcode RM15 4NH is located in a rural town, within the Aveley and Uplands ward of Thurrock in the East of England region, and forms part of the Aveley area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 79.6 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, in line with the East of England average of 82 per 1,000. The average income per household in Aveley is £55,511 per year. The nearest station is Ockendon, about 1.8 miles away. There are 3 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est large park is Kennington Park.

Frequently asked questions about RM15 4NH

Is RM15 4NH (Aveley) safe?

The area around RM15 4NH records about 80 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a high crime rate for England: it scores 8 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across East of England as a whole the rate is about 82 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, anti-social behaviour and criminal damage and arson.

What is the average house price near RM15 4NH?

The median sale price around RM15 4NH in Aveley is £380,000 (about £419 per square foot) based on 109 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

What schools are near RM15 4NH?

There are 4 schools close to RM15 4NH, including Kenningtons Primary Academy (Good), Ormiston Park Academy (Good) and Aveley Primary School (Good). Ratings are from the latest Ofsted inspections.

How deprived is the area around RM15 4NH?

RM15 4NH scores 7 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. Its neighbourhood ranks 9,021 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).

Who represents RM15 4NH (Aveley) in Parliament and on the local council?

The Member of Parliament for Thurrock covering RM15 4NH is Jennifer Craft (Labour Party), elected at the 2024 general election. The area is represented by 1 local councillor: Cathy Sisterson (Labour Party).
